A Sneak Peak at car Force One: The Most High Tech Cab in New York Today

If you happen to be in New York, there's a good chance you'll get to see the hottest and coolest taxi cab there is...it's none other than the Car Force One. Sounds intimidating, right? And no, it's not the official car of President Barack Obama however, it is one ride that's fit for His Excellency. The Car Force One, which is founded and currently owned by Ishai (last name not revealed), is a luxury car service that transports you around New York along with tons of up-to-date amenities with no additional charge.

According to Ishai, his company's goal is to achieve full customer satisfaction. “My company is not about the car, it’s about the service. It’s for the clients,” said Ishai. Since July 2009, Ishai has been a cab driver and has been developing his vehicles with the help of his creative team. So what's in store with the most high-tech cab in New York? His 2011 Chevrolet SUV's loaded with gadgets such as an Xbox 360, which will be upgraded to Sony PlayStation 4 once it goes available, a 23-inch Samsung HD monitor, cable TV with premium HD channels, a Blu-Ray player, 4G Internet connection, a fully functioning laptop, refreshments, and the list goes on.


Ishai created the Car Force One with 3 visions in mind -- convenience and comfort, multimedia entertainment, and a fully-equipped mobile office. These are major plus points, especially for people in New York, who always do business even when traveling and wants everything done in a jiffy. Dying to get a ride in the Car Force One? Reservations start at $45 for a trip from the Upper West Side to Wall Street, while shorter distances start at $35. Not a bad deal since the same trip will set you back some $30 in a regular yellow cab during moderate traffic, including a 20% tip. According to Ishai, a minimum fee for reservations is imposed because of the commitment it makes, as well as the opportunity cost involved. The company also doesn't charge cancellation or change fees. For regulars, he offers better rates and sometimes even offers free rides for short trips when he's not busy during his in-between client time.

Here's the catch, though. If you are planning to make a reservation of the Car Force One today and expect to get a ride the next day, then you're in for a huge disappointment. Making a reservation of the Car Force One should be done as early as possible because of its very tight schedule. The company receives bookings for March as early as 6-9 months before the book date. Most customers hire the company's high-tech vehicle for airport and business pickups.
